Yonaka hook up with Sampha/The XX producer for debut EP

Riding a wave of buzz for their incredible live shows, Brighton's Yonaka have unveiled their debut, five-track EP Heavy alongside lead track "Bubblegum".
Roping in Rodaidh Mcdonald (The xx, Sampha) on production, the band celebrated the EP release earlier this week with a trio of sold out shows all on the same night at Camden's Lock Tavern, with queues down the street for wristbands.
"Bubblegum" was showcased for the first time on Huw Stephens’ Radio 1 show last month via a live session from Maida Vale’s Abbey Road Studios.
